Is it common to have things living in your favia? When I bought it over a year ago, it seem to have a tiny hole in it. I never thought too much of it, just figured it was one of mother natures defects. Well the hole has enlarged just a bit since then. I was looking at it really closely the other day and I saw a little critter face staring back at me. I would have snapped a picture but I think it is too small to show up. Anyway, I didn't know if it was common to have stuff bore into favia and live there?
 
there are such things as gall crabs that live symbioticly with the corals. if you've had it for a year and the coral is growing and healthy then i don't think that i would personally remove it, you might end up doing more harm then good. but if it is harming the coral, then by all means get it out. search for gall crabs in this forum. there has been a lot of discussion about them.
